- 十二、链
- 12. 链
- 12.1 使用类
- 12.2 方法说明
- 12.2.1 重置链的迭代器
- 12.2.2 迭代完成
- 12.2.3 迭代器当前元素
- 12.2.4 迭代器下一个元素
- 12.2.5 迭代器上一个元素
- 12.2.6 迭代器是否有下一个对象
- 12.2.7 迭代器是否有上一个对象
- 12.2.8 从当前对象克隆一个 Chain
- 12. 链
十二、链
12. 链
12.1 使用类
org.voovan.tools.Chain
12.2 方法说明
12.2.1 重置链的迭代器
public void rewind()
12.2.2 迭代完成
public void stop()
12.2.3 迭代器当前元素
public E current()
返回值
: 当前元素
12.2.4 迭代器下一个元素
public E next()
返回值
: 下一个元素
12.2.5 迭代器上一个元素
public E previous()
返回值
: 上一个元素
12.2.6 迭代器是否有下一个对象
public boolean hasNext()
返回值
: 是否有下一个对象
12.2.7 迭代器是否有上一个对象
public boolean hasPrevious()
返回值
: 是否有上一个对象
12.2.8 从当前对象克隆一个 Chain
public Chain<E> clone()
对象内的元素共用指针
返回值
: 克隆后的对象